Hi at all
I have a PC with OS : win xp (SP2) I wrote a software that starts automatically when I sswitch on the PC so the access to Xp is permit directly to the administrator without password (I know that it's the only manner to lunch a software on PC that works alone) In that situation can I permit the access from the network with Login and Password? It's possible to permit a different access for different network user? TIA |

Spingo, Windows NT, 2000, and XP provide for a default, non-GUI authenticated login, called by some "auto admin login". If you set the admin login account and password in the registry, when you restart the computer, it will automatically login, and execute an unattended login script. This is used by some corporations for mass installs and maintenance. If the auto admin login has been setup, holding down an appropriate key combination (either Shift or Ctrl, IIRC), bypasses the auto login, and allows you to enter a non default (ie login as you would normally). Otherwise, you'd be stuck with a computer doing nothing but executing an unattended login script, and restarting. -- Cheers, Chuck, MS-MVP [Windows - Networking] http://nitecruzr.blogspot.com/ Paranoia is not a problem, when it's a normal response from experience.
